PR: North Ferriby vs Knaresborough

North Ferriby FC start a run of four consecutive home games as they take on Knaresborough Town at the Dransfield stadium this weekend.

Chris Bolder’s side will look to keep their 100%-win rate at home going. The Villagers come into the game off the back of a disappointing loss to Albion Sports during the week. The Villagers had the opportunity to pull six points clear of Emley in second place. Two second-half goals from the hosts proved the difference in the end.

Paul Robson, North Ferriby Fc assistant manager, summed up his thoughts after the game, it was another game that we’ve been below par. We started ok in the game, we put 15 crosses in the box by half time and we didn’t connect on them, it was disappointing as it was a big opportunity for us to go six points clear at the top, but we ourselves down.

Knaresborough currently sit in 16th place. In their eleven games this season they have picked up thirteen points. Last time out they defeated title challengers Barton, with a final score of 2-1. Danny Edwards is Knaresborough’s top goal scorer, with seven goals in total.

Paul Robson summed up his thoughts ahead of the game, “we’re looking forward to getting back on our pitch. It’ll be nice to get back into our groove and play how we want to play. Some of the away games we’ve completely come away from it, we haven’t been doing the simple things right”.
